A Family Tale with Complications
Eight-year-old Michael Flintlock’s world is upended when he catches Grandpa wearing a Santa suit—shattering his belief in the holiday’s most famous jolly old fellow.
Disillusioned, Michael channels his frustration into his artwork, unknowingly bringing to life a new Santa Claus.
But this Santa isn’t here to deliver gifts. Instead, he whisks Michael and his family into an extraordinary world shaped by imagination and mystery.
Separated across surreal landscapes, each family member must confront their deepest flaws and learn to understand one another—before they are lost in this fantastical world forever.
Michael didn’t like the truth about Santa.
So he rewrote it—with crayons… and interdimensional consequences
Fantastical Nature is an illustrated modern fantasy that intertwines holiday magic with a child’s boundless creativity, with a blend of whimsical adventure and heartfelt themes, in the vein of The Neverending Story and The Marvelous Land of Oz.
